In "\Steam\steamapps\common\Portal 2\portal2\puzzles[17-digit]\", I see a bunch of .p2c_12 and .p2c_13 files. Are these auto-save or back-up files of some kind? Can I safely delete them without it affecting something else?

No, the PTI maps are normally in P2C files.

Wildgoosespeeder, try moving those files to your desktop and launching Portal 2. See what's different. If it's bad just move them back.

These seem to be older versions of the same maps. In addition, the data format in the p2c_12 files differs substantially from the others. (Open them in Notepad and have a look.)

My theory is that the P2C file format got changed at some point and these files are backups made during the conversion process. If I look at the timestamps of the files, the p2c_12 and p2c_13 versions of a map always have the exact same timestamp, which is (much) older than the "normal" P2C file. So they were probably made at one point in time and are not continually updated.

I think it's safe to clean them up, but first move them to a different folder and see if your maps still open and compile properly.
